How Does Amazon FBA Shipping China to Italy Compare to Other Options?
When evaluating Amazon FBA shipping China to Italy, it is crucial to compare the primary modes of transport against your delivery deadlines. While sea freight remains the most economical choice for large volumes, it requires the longest lead times. On the other hand, air freight provides rapid delivery at a significantly higher price point per kilogram.
Rail freight has emerged as a popular middle ground, offering faster transit than sea and lower costs than air. However, rail availability can fluctuate based on geopolitical stability and infrastructure demand across the Eurasian corridors. Therefore, businesses must weigh these factors carefully before committing to a specific logistics strategy.
In addition to the main methods, hybrid solutions like sea-air combinations are becoming more prevalent in 2026. These strategies allow sellers to save money while still beating the standard ocean transit times. Indeed, selecting the right method is often a matter of balancing the urgency of the shipment against the available budget.
| Shipping Method | Cost Range | Transit Time | Best For |
|---|---|---|---|
| Sea Freight (FCL) | $3,000 – $4,200 | 30-40 Days | Bulk Inventory |
| Air Freight | $5.50 – $8.50/kg | 5-8 Days | Urgent Restocks |
| Rail Freight | $120 – $180/CBM | 18-25 Days | Medium Volume |
| Express Service | $9.00 – $12.00/kg | 3-5 Days | Small Samples |

Navigating Sea Freight for Italian Fulfillment Centers
Utilizing sea freight is the most common strategy for established Amazon sellers who move significant volumes. This method allows for the shipment of Full Container Loads (FCL) or Less than Container Loads (LCL) depending on the total cargo size. Consequently, it offers the lowest cost per unit, which is vital for maintaining healthy profit margins.
During the 2026 peak season, ocean rates typically see an increase of 15% to 25% due to higher demand. Therefore, booking your shipments at least 4-6 weeks in advance is highly recommended to secure space and stable pricing. Additionally, choosing the right port of discharge, such as Genoa or La Spezia, can reduce inland haulage times to Italian warehouses.

FCL vs LCL: Which Should You Choose?
For shipments exceeding 15 cubic meters, FCL is generally more cost-effective and provides better security for your goods. In contrast, LCL is ideal for smaller shipments but involves more handling and a higher risk of minor delays during consolidation. Air Freight: Ensuring Speed for High-Demand Products
When inventory levels drop unexpectedly, air freight becomes the indispensable solution for Italian Amazon sellers. This method bypasses the long maritime routes, ensuring that your products are live on the marketplace within a week. Furthermore, air transport reduces the risk of damage and theft compared to other modes of transit.
Although the costs are higher, the speed of air freight allows for faster capital turnover and minimizes the risk of losing your Amazon ranking. Specifically, for high-margin items or seasonal products, the investment in air transport is often justified by the avoided loss of sales. Moreover, modern tracking systems provide real-time visibility into your cargo’s progress.
As of early 2026, air cargo capacity from major Chinese hubs like Shenzhen and Shanghai to Milan Malpensa remains steady. However, fuel surcharges can fluctuate, so it is wise to monitor the market closely. Consequently, working with a freight forwarder who has blocked space agreements can provide more reliable pricing.
The Role of Rail Freight in 2026 Logistics
The expansion of the Iron Silk Road has made rail freight a viable alternative for shipping to Italy. This mode offers a transit time that is significantly faster than sea freight while remaining much cheaper than air. Accordingly, many sellers use rail for mid-sized shipments that require a balance of speed and economy.
Rail services typically connect major Chinese industrial cities directly to European rail hubs, where cargo is then trucked to Italian FBA warehouses. This door-to-door approach simplifies the logistics chain and reduces the number of touchpoints. Nevertheless, sellers should be aware of potential seasonal congestion at border crossings during the winter months.

Customs Clearance and Italy Import Regulations
Navigating the Italian customs landscape requires precision and thorough documentation to avoid costly storage fees at the port. Professional customs brokerage services are essential for ensuring that all VAT and duty requirements are met correctly. Furthermore, Italian authorities are strict regarding product compliance and labeling for the EU market.
Sellers must ensure they have a valid EORI number and that all commercial invoices accurately reflect the value and nature of the goods. Failure to provide correct documentation can lead to shipments being held for inspection, which disrupts your Amazon inventory flow. Consequently, proactive preparation is the key to a smooth customs clearance process.
In 2026, digital customs platforms have streamlined the filing process, but manual inspections still occur for certain product categories. Moreover, understanding the specific HS codes for your products will help in calculating accurate landed costs. Therefore, consulting with a logistics expert before shipping is always a prudent step.
| Document Name | Purpose | Required By | Timing |
|---|---|---|---|
| Commercial Invoice | Value Declaration | Customs | At Loading |
| Packing List | Content Verification | Warehouse/Customs | At Loading |
| Bill of Lading | Title of Goods | Carrier | Post-Departure |
| Certificate of Origin | Duty Calculation | Italian Customs | Pre-Arrival |

Real-World Case Studies for 2026
Case Study 1: Electronics Restock. Route: Shenzhen to Milan. Cargo: 500kg of Smart Home Devices. Method: Air Freight. Cost: $3,800. Timeline: 6 days door-to-door. Insight: Using air freight allowed the seller to maintain their ‘Best Seller’ badge during a sudden demand spike.
Case Study 2: Kitchenware Bulk Order. Route: Ningbo to Genoa. Cargo: 15 CBM (LCL). Method: Sea Freight. Cost: $1,450. Timeline: 38 days. Insight: Booking 5 weeks in advance secured a lower rate before the Q4 peak season price hike.
Case Study 3: Furniture Sample Batch. Route: Chengdu to Verona. Cargo: 3 CBM. Method: Rail Freight. Cost: $550. Timeline: 22 days. Insight: Rail provided a cost-effective way to send large samples that were too heavy for air but needed faster than sea.
